    • An actuator mechanism is defined by a lever arm that integrally connected to resilient spring members. The lever arm is movable between first and second positions and is normally biased into the first portion in which the actuator may engage an adjacent member, for example to provide a fluid-tight sealing relationship of to lock the adjacent member in a stationary position relative to the lever arm. Movement of the lever arm into the second position releases the engagement with the adjacent member. In one embodiment the actuator is defined by a pair of overlapping, oppositely oriented slots cut into a monolithic member to define both the lever arm and the spring members. The lever arm rocks in a teeter-toter fashion when actuated and both ends of the lever arm can be utilized to perform work.

    • PROBLEM TO BE SOLVED: To provide an expansion stay which can be assembled by few parts without requiring special work for installing a guide member. SOLUTION: This expansion stay has a stay body 16 including an inside arm 12 and an outside arm 14 slidingly fitted with this inside arm 12. A lock rod 54 is fitted in and locked on a lock hole 56 arranged in the inside arm by a lock spring 52 arranged in the guide member 50 installed in the outside arm 14 for locking these inside-outside arms 12 and 14 in a predetermined overlapping position. The guide member 50 is arranged in a cylindrical part 60 penetrating through a plate part 14AW of the outside arm 14, and has a base part 62 engaging with an inside surface of this plate part 14AW.
